Core Viewpoint - The narrative logic of the light industry retail beauty sector is shifting from "expansion" to "quality improvement" by 2026, driven by consumer demand for emotional and functional value, supply upgrades, and supportive consumption policies [1] Demand Trends - Four major demand trends in the light industry retail beauty sector are identified: sustained emotional consumption, coexistence of rational and high-end consumption recovery, dominance of functional demand, and continued preference for domestic brands, influenced by demographic changes and generational shifts [4] - The rise of Generation Z is leading to a "self-pleasure" consumption transformation, with this demographic contributing 22.5% of total consumption despite only representing 23.3% of the population [12][14] - Interest consumption is characterized by high frequency, high stickiness, and low price sensitivity, with 47% of consumers regularly paying for interests [14] Supply Innovations - Three types of supply innovations are observed: creating new categories (e.g.,潮玩), developing new functionalities (e.g., PDRN in beauty products), and integrating new technologies (e.g., AI glasses) [4][22] - The潮玩 industry exemplifies the creation of new categories, fulfilling emotional and interest needs of adult consumers, with significant revenue growth reported by leading companies [22][24] - New functionalities in products, such as PDRN, are gaining popularity, with substantial increases in search volume and sales during promotional events [27][31] Policy Support - Current consumption support policies aim to establish a systematic long-term mechanism, focusing on enhancing consumer quality and optimizing service products [4][32] - Policies are designed to stimulate demand through mechanisms like "old-for-new" exchanges and to guide industries towards intelligent and functional upgrades [32][33] Investment Strategy - Investment should focus on three main lines: long-term positioning in emotional and functional consumption sectors, actively seeking opportunities catalyzed by new technologies, and identifying companies poised for fundamental recovery supported by stimulus policies [37][38] Industry Outlook - The beauty and medical aesthetics sector is expected to see growth driven by supply-side innovations, with domestic brands likely to continue gaining market share [5][40] - The潮玩 retail sector is projected to maintain high global demand, with leading companies innovating in product categories and IP operations [5][40] - The light manufacturing sector is anticipated to experience a weak recovery in demand, with structural opportunities for export-oriented companies [5][40] Consumer Behavior - A "K-shaped" consumption differentiation is emerging, with rational consumption increasing sensitivity to prices while high-end consumption shows signs of recovery [15][47] - The demand for functional products is becoming a dominant factor in purchasing decisions, with consumers increasingly valuing product quality and service over marketing [17][19] Market Dynamics - The retail market is experiencing a mild recovery, with service consumption growing faster than goods retail, driven by policy support and improved service supply [6][58] - The competition among brands is intensifying, leading to a decline in gross sales margins and a concentration of market share among leading brands [50][56]
